1.introduce asynchronous execution API:
libxl__async_exec_init
libxl__async_exec_start
libxl__async_exec_inuse
2.use the async exec API to execute device hotplug scripts

+/*----- asynchronous function -----*/
+typedef struct libxl__async_exec_state libxl__async_exec_state;
+
+typedef void libxl__async_exec_callback(libxl__egc *egc,
+ libxl__async_exec_state *aes, int status);
+
+struct libxl__async_exec_state {
+ /* caller must fill these in */
+ libxl__ao *ao;
+ const char *what; /* for error msgs, what we're execute */
+ char **env; /* execution environment */
+ char **args; /* execution arguments */
+ libxl__async_exec_callback *callback;
+ int timeout_ms;
+ int stdfds[3];
+
+ /* private */
+ libxl__ev_time time;
+ libxl__ev_child child;
+};
+
+void libxl__async_exec_init(libxl__async_exec_state *aes);
+int libxl__async_exec_start(libxl__gc *gc, libxl__async_exec_state *aes);
+bool libxl__async_exec_inuse(const libxl__async_exec_state *aes);
+
